Full Body Kettlebell Workout – Alabama

This kettlebell workout was filmed in Alabama  when we visited the Tannehill Ironworks Historical State Park. How could I pass lifting iron at an old ironworks furnance? The ironworks industry in Alabama played an important role during The Civil War supplying much of the iron used for the war. This particular furnace was nearly destroyed by Union forces during the last months of the war.

This little Union soldier better watch out he is in in Confederate territory.

History lesson over. Now onto the workout.

Alabama

Part One

Turkish Get Ups – Alternate Sides for 7 minutes

Part Two

2a. Thrusters – 5 on each side
2b. Burpees (push up optional) – 5

Alternate between 2a and 2b for 7 minutes.

Part 1 – Turkish Get Ups are one of my favorite kettlebell exercises that I, honestly, don’t practice enough. Not only are they are excellent for developing mobility, stability, and overall strength, they are beautiful and relaxing.  I started with the Get Ups, as opposed to putting them at the end, while I was strong and without any sort of fatigue.

Part 2 – Find a pace that is challenging but not but not excruciating. You should never be in “pain”. Discomfort, yes. Pain, no. It’s important to learn to tell the difference.
